USDOT contemplates electronic recordkeeping for drug & alcohol documents

The United States Department of Transportation (USDOT) is seeking comments on how its regulations for conducting workplace drug and alcohol testing for federally-regulated transportation companies should be amended to allow the use of electronic signatures and the electronic storage of forms and data. DOT proposes to allow oral fluid drug testing

In a notice published to the Federal Register on February 28, 2022, the United States Department of Transportation (USDOT) is proposing to revise its existing drug and alcohol testing rules in 49 CFR Part 40 to, among other things, expand the allowable methods for DOT drug testing to include oral fluids. FMCSA to require states to downgrade CDLs due to drug/alcohol violations

The FMCSA has published a final rule requiring SDLAs to downgrade CDLs of drivers who have violated the federal drug/alcohol rules.

What is the FMCSA's Drug & Alcohol Clearinghouse?

The Clearinghouse is a central repository administered by the FMCSA for drug & alcohol testing violation data on all commercial drivers.
